News

But how many developers understand how HashMap works internally? A few days ago, I read a lot of the source code for ...
JDK 25 is an LTS release, the second on Oracle’s new two-year LTS cadence (after 21), and it lands with meaningful language ...
C++, a programming language with a long history yet always fresh, has a legendary status in the world of programming ...
JavaScript is a sprawling and ever-changing behemoth, and may be the single-most connective piece of web technology. From AI ...
Find out what's up in your night sky during September 2025 and how to see it in this Space.com stargazing guide. Looking for a telescope for the next night sky event? We recommend the Celestron ...
Whether you start each day with a cup of coffee or you’re looking for the best coffee shop in the Bay Area to relax on a weekend afternoon, this list is for you. Based on the results of this year’s ...
ChatGPT can help write code in many languages, but it’s a tool to assist, not replace, human programmers. Writing good ...
Seek Early Experience: Don’t wait until you feel like an expert to look for internships or entry-level roles. Getting some ...
This project implements SimplePIM, a software framework for easy and efficient in-memory-hardware programming. The code is implemented on UPMEM, an actual, commercially available PIM hardware that ...